For those that don't know Automotive Elegance is the installer that Macmulkin uses for their PPF packages.

I had the Macmulkin full package done to my C7, I would describe the job as "journeyman". It wasn't bad, but it wasn't great either. There were some edges where the cut files were used where I think they could have extended and wrapped without needing disassembly, or even a lot of effort. Arguably the worst part is that there is no paint correction so you are locking in any paint defects from the factory. But those packages are designed to 1) be cheap and 2) be done in volume at Macmulkin's shop.

That said, expect to pay a lot more than what Macmulkin asks if you want a full custom wrap job.
